An Indiana man stabbed his son in the heart after an argument over dirty dishes left in the sink, police said.
The suspect, Timothy Ray Lisby, 59, was originally charged with aggravated assault and is being held without bail, according to Marion County Jail records.
But a family friend who witnessed the brutal death of 31-year-old Christopher Allen Risby on June 14 told Fox 59 that the father should be charged with murder. Since the assault charges were filed, the case has been handed over to homicide detectives and the investigation continues, according to the outlet.

Jeremiah Green told the outlet that after an argument over a pile of dirty dishes, Lisby and her son wrestled to the floor inside their mobile home on Doggie Road in Indianapolis.
Then Brother Lisby attacked him with a knife.
“Tim had a spoon in his hand and he started stabbing Chris with it,” Green told the outlet. “Chris said, ‘Jeremiah, get the spoon out of your hand,’ and so I did.”
The father then grabbed another weapon, Green said.
“Tim ran into the kitchen, grabbed something shiny, something sharp and stabbed it as hard as he could into Chris’ chest,” Green said.

Green called 911, the outlet reported, and Indianapolis Police Department officers arrived on the scene, where they found Lisby in the living room with “a bleeding wound to the chest,” according to an affidavit into the incident obtained by Law & Crime.
Police said Christopher Risby was rushed to a nearby hospital where he underwent surgery for a lacerated heart and was in stable condition, but died from his injuries the following day.
Green called for help, and his father realised the seriousness of the situation and tried to administer first aid to his son.
